INTERVIEWS ON CHURCH GROWTH HISTORY IN MOHALE'S HOEK

On the 3rd January as the efford was to begin that evenning I intervied Mrs Mamonoang Lebakeng, Mrs Mamohlahle Namanyane and Mr Mosiuoa Kou who happen to be old members of this church.

They told me that about distance of 200 metres where the tent was pitched was tent in 1971by Pastor Chalale which prepare them to get baptised in 1972 except for Mr Kou who was already a member as the church first came to Mohale’s Hoek.

QUESTION ON CHURCH GROWTH

I asked them to mention things that might have contributed to poor church growth in the south.

THINGS THAT CONTRIBUTED IN POOR CHURCH GROWTH

- Lack of church services such as schools, clinics etc.
- Their members move to the church institutions in the North for work.
- All the Pastors were from the North and so seemed to have had a heart to develop home.
- Most efforts were done in the North and they seemed to have been neglected.
